		<title>Pedal Power</title>
		<link>http://www.metafilter.com/65499/Pedal%2DPower</link>
		<description> &lt;a href=&quot;http://www.expedition360.com/who_we_are/jason_lewis_bio.htm&quot;&gt;Jason Lewis &lt;/a&gt;has become the first man to &lt;a href=&quot;http://news.bbc.co.uk/1/hi/england/dorset/7031576.stm&quot;&gt;circumnavigate the Earth&lt;/a&gt; using human power alone. It only took him 13 years: he set off from London in July, 1994 and ended his expedition in October, 2007, having travelled 46,505 miles (on foot and by pedal boat, roller blades, kayak, and bicycle). [via &lt;a href=&quot;http://www.qi.com/&quot;&gt;QI&lt;/a&gt;] He was struck by a driver in Pueblo, Colorado, and spent nine months recovering from two broken legs, returning to the trek in May 1996. He was also arrested on suspicion of spying in Sudan. </description>

		<title>One Long Walk</title>
		<link>http://www.metafilter.com/40041/One%2DLong%2DWalk</link>
		<description>&lt;a href="http://constanttrek.com/Constanttrek.htm"&gt;Constant Trek&lt;/a&gt; is the Australian husband and wife team of Gary and Paula Constant.  On the 1st of August, 2004, they left London from Trafalgar square to walk to Cape Town in South Africa.  It is a distance of over 10,500 miles, and has been four years in the planning.  </description>
